Presented below is the balance sheet of Hellman Company at January 1,2015:
 Cash $100 Net Fixed Assets 400 Total Assets $500\begin{array}{ll}\text { Cash } & \$ 100 \\\text { Net Fixed Assets } & {400} \\\text { Total Assets } &{\$ 500}\end{array}
 Accounts Payable $20 Long-term Bonds Payable 220 Stockholders’ Equity 260 Total Liabilities and Stockholders’ Equity $500\begin{array}{ll}\text { Accounts Payable } & \$ 20 \\\text { Long-term Bonds Payable } & 220 \\\text { Stockholders' Equity } & \underline{260} \\\text { Total Liabilities and Stockholders' Equity } & \$ 500\end{array}
The balance sheet of Swenson Company at January 1,2015 is below:
 Cash $400 Net Fixed Assets 380 Total Assets $780\begin{array}{ll}\text { Cash } & \$ 400 \\\text { Net Fixed Assets } & {380} \\\text { Total Assets } & {\$ 780}\end{array}
 Accounts Payable $120 Long-term Bonds Payable 280 Stockholders’ Equity 380 Total Liabilities and Stockholders’ Equity $780\begin{array}{ll}\text { Accounts Payable } & \$ 120 \\\text { Long-term Bonds Payable } & 280 \\\text { Stockholders' Equity } & 380 \\\text { Total Liabilities and Stockholders' Equity } & \$ 780\end{array}
On January 1,2015,Swenson Company acquired 100 percent of the outstanding common stock of Hellman Company for $260 cash.The book value and fair value of Hellman's assets and liabilities were equal.The net income for the year ending December 31,2015 was $30 for Hellman Company.The net income for the year ending December 31,2015 was $40 for Swenson Company.There were no intercompany sales.What is the net income on the consolidated income statement for the year ended December 31,2015?

Leeward Side

The side of a mountain or hill sheltered from the wind; typically receives less precipitation.

Windward Side

The side of a mountain, island, or other land mass that faces the direction from which the wind is coming, often receiving more rainfall than the leeward side.

El Niño-Southern Oscillation

A climate phenomenon characterized by the periodic warming of sea surface temperatures in the central and eastern Pacific Ocean, affecting weather patterns globally.

Prevailing Easterly Winds

Winds that typically blow from the east, common in tropical regions close to the equator due to the Earth's rotation and atmospheric conditions.
